Output 4089ca17546cfaceb4bb5d9122fd988bd58955e33223a6cd4409d995191b510f:21

value
189313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1af86215b2ce9935edc934bdca8a8a04abcccd5c OP_EQUAL
address
349d3VeUHMSa5tBdY5znEQAjwDenFRiQbP
transaction
4089ca17546cfaceb4bb5d9122fd988bd58955e33223a6cd4409d995191b510f
spent
true